Core Judging Criteria

In the ring, a judge must demonstrate an unwavering commitment to the objective assessment of each entry. The following criteria serve as the foundation for his evaluation process:

  • Movement and Gait Analysis: The judge evaluates the efficiency of the dog's locomotion, looking for sound drive, reach, and the correct placement of limbs while in motion to ensure functional health.
  • Anatomical Balance and Proportions: This involves a meticulous assessment of bone structure, skeletal angulation, and the overall harmony of the dog's silhouette as defined by the official standard.
  • Breed Type and Expression: The judge examines the specific head properties, including the skull-to-muzzle ratio, eye placement, and ear set, which collectively define the unique character of the animal.
  • Temperament and Ring Demeanor: A critical component of the evaluation is the dog's confidence and stability, ensuring that the animal exhibits the appropriate temperament required for its historical purpose.
